hacienda
(noun) the main house on a ranch or large estate
hacienda
(noun) a large estate in Spanish-speaking countries

hacienda (plural haciendas)
A large homestead in a ranch or estate usually in places where Colonial Spanish culture has had architectural influence.

Ha`ci*en"da ( or ), n. Etym: [Sp., fr. OSp. facienda employment, estate, fr. L. facienda, pl. of faciendum what is to be done, fr. facere to do. See Fact.]
Definition: A large estate where work of any kind is done, as agriculture, manufacturing, mining, or raising of animals; a cultivated farm, with a good house, in distinction from a farming establishment with rude huts for herdsmen, etc.; -- a word used in Spanish-American regions. 1.
